Implementation notes: amd64, pmnod076, crypto_aead/norx6461v1

Computer: pmnod076
Architecture: amd64
CPU ID: GenuineIntel-00050657-bfebfbff
SUPERCOP version: 20191017
Operation: crypto_aead
Primitive: norx6461v1
TimeObject sizeTest sizeImplementationCompilerBenchmark dateSUPERCOP version
242088440 0 031773 856 928ymmicc_-march=skylake-avx512_-mtune=skylake-avx512_-O2_-fomit-frame-pointer2019102320191017
243688424 0 031933 856 928ymmicc_-march=icelake-client_-mtune=icelake-client_-O3_-fomit-frame-pointer2019102320191017
243748440 0 031661 856 928ymmicc_-march=skylake-avx512_-mtune=skylake-avx512_-O3_-fomit-frame-pointer2019102320191017
243948424 0 032285 856 928ymmicc_-march=icelake-client_-mtune=icelake-client_-O2_-fomit-frame-pointer2019102320191017
247026696 0 023270 824 896ymmgc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102320191017
247446696 0 025987 832 896ymmgc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102320191017
248026430 0 021478 808 896ymmgc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102320191017
251068296 0 031013 856 864ymmicc_-march=core-avx-i_-mtune=core-avx-i_-O2_-fomit-frame-pointer2019102320191017
251488296 0 031013 856 864ymmicc_-march=corei7-avx_-mtune=corei7-avx_-O2_-fomit-frame-pointer2019102320191017
251568296 0 031045 856 864ymmicc_-march=ivybridge_-mtune=ivybridge_-O3_-fomit-frame-pointer2019102320191017
251608296 0 031045 856 864ymmicc_-march=sandybridge_-mtune=sandybridge_-O3_-fomit-frame-pointer2019102320191017
251628296 0 031045 856 864ymmicc_-march=corei7-avx_-mtune=corei7-avx_-O3_-fomit-frame-pointer2019102320191017
251628296 0 031013 856 864ymmicc_-march=ivybridge_-mtune=ivybridge_-O2_-fomit-frame-pointer2019102320191017
251928296 0 031045 856 864ymmicc_-march=core-avx-i_-mtune=core-avx-i_-O3_-fomit-frame-pointer2019102320191017
252147960 0 030613 856 864ymmicc_-march=core-avx2_-mtune=core-avx2_-O3_-fomit-frame-pointer2019102320191017
252287976 0 029381 856 864ymmicc_-march=corei7_-mtune=corei7_-O2_-fomit-frame-pointer2019102320191017
252427960 0 031013 856 864ymmicc_-march=haswell_-mtune=haswell_-O2_-fomit-frame-pointer2019102320191017
252547960 0 031013 856 864ymmicc_-march=core-avx2_-mtune=core-avx2_-O2_-fomit-frame-pointer2019102320191017
252647960 0 031013 856 864ymmicc_-march=broadwell_-mtune=broadwell_-O2_-fomit-frame-pointer2019102320191017
252807976 0 029437 856 864ymmicc_-march=corei7_-mtune=corei7_-O3_-fomit-frame-pointer2019102320191017
252847960 0 030613 856 864ymmicc_-march=haswell_-mtune=haswell_-O3_-fomit-frame-pointer2019102320191017
257228296 0 031013 856 864ymmicc_-march=sandybridge_-mtune=sandybridge_-O2_-fomit-frame-pointer2019102320191017
257747960 0 030613 856 864ymmicc_-march=skylake_-mtune=skylake_-O3_-fomit-frame-pointer2019102320191017
258027960 0 030613 856 864ymmicc_-march=broadwell_-mtune=broadwell_-O3_-fomit-frame-pointer2019102320191017
258167960 0 031013 856 864ymmicc_-march=skylake_-mtune=skylake_-O2_-fomit-frame-pointer2019102320191017
281007754 0 024094 824 896ymmgc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102320191017
2982412264 0 035597 856 928xmmicc_-march=skylake-avx512_-mtune=skylake-avx512_-O2_-fomit-frame-pointer2019102320191017
2991812264 0 036125 856 928xmmicc_-march=icelake-client_-mtune=icelake-client_-O2_-fomit-frame-pointer2019102320191017
2991812264 0 035485 856 928xmmicc_-march=skylake-avx512_-mtune=skylake-avx512_-O3_-fomit-frame-pointer2019102320191017
2994612264 0 035773 856 928xmmicc_-march=icelake-client_-mtune=icelake-client_-O3_-fomit-frame-pointer2019102320191017
3058610575 0 027134 824 896xmmgc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102320191017
3061810575 0 029867 832 896xmmgc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102320191017
3099210300 0 025334 808 896xmmgc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102320191017
3172211400 0 034133 856 864xmmicc_-march=corei7-avx_-mtune=corei7-avx_-O3_-fomit-frame-pointer2019102320191017
3173611416 0 034117 856 864xmmicc_-march=core-avx-i_-mtune=core-avx-i_-O2_-fomit-frame-pointer2019102320191017
3174411400 0 034133 856 864xmmicc_-march=core-avx-i_-mtune=core-avx-i_-O3_-fomit-frame-pointer2019102320191017
3174811416 0 034117 856 864xmmicc_-march=corei7-avx_-mtune=corei7-avx_-O2_-fomit-frame-pointer2019102320191017
3175211400 0 034133 856 864xmmicc_-march=ivybridge_-mtune=ivybridge_-O3_-fomit-frame-pointer2019102320191017
3176611400 0 034133 856 864xmmicc_-march=sandybridge_-mtune=sandybridge_-O3_-fomit-frame-pointer2019102320191017
3176811416 0 034117 856 864xmmicc_-march=ivybridge_-mtune=ivybridge_-O2_-fomit-frame-pointer2019102320191017
3182811416 0 034117 856 864xmmicc_-march=sandybridge_-mtune=sandybridge_-O2_-fomit-frame-pointer2019102320191017
3194611400 0 034053 856 864xmmicc_-march=haswell_-mtune=haswell_-O3_-fomit-frame-pointer2019102320191017
3197611416 0 034469 856 864xmmicc_-march=haswell_-mtune=haswell_-O2_-fomit-frame-pointer2019102320191017
3198011416 0 034469 856 864xmmicc_-march=broadwell_-mtune=broadwell_-O2_-fomit-frame-pointer2019102320191017
3198611416 0 034469 856 864xmmicc_-march=skylake_-mtune=skylake_-O2_-fomit-frame-pointer2019102320191017
3202211400 0 034053 856 864xmmicc_-march=broadwell_-mtune=broadwell_-O3_-fomit-frame-pointer2019102320191017
3204211400 0 034053 856 864xmmicc_-march=core-avx2_-mtune=core-avx2_-O3_-fomit-frame-pointer2019102320191017
3207011416 0 034469 856 864xmmicc_-march=core-avx2_-mtune=core-avx2_-O2_-fomit-frame-pointer2019102320191017
3208411400 0 034053 856 864xmmicc_-march=skylake_-mtune=skylake_-O3_-fomit-frame-pointer2019102320191017
3209612460 0 028782 824 896xmmgc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102320191017
3227814024 0 035413 856 864xmmicc_-march=corei7_-mtune=corei7_-O2_-fomit-frame-pointer2019102320191017
3228014024 0 035469 856 864xmmicc_-march=corei7_-mtune=corei7_-O3_-fomit-frame-pointer2019102320191017
411723436 8 018579 816 896refgc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102320191017
4339039296 0 062077 856 864reficc_-march=corei7-avx_-mtune=corei7-avx_-O3_-fomit-frame-pointer2019102320191017
4344038944 0 061693 856 864reficc_-march=ivybridge_-mtune=ivybridge_-O2_-fomit-frame-pointer2019102320191017
4369039296 0 062077 856 864reficc_-march=ivybridge_-mtune=ivybridge_-O3_-fomit-frame-pointer2019102320191017
4375438944 0 061693 856 864reficc_-march=corei7-avx_-mtune=corei7-avx_-O2_-fomit-frame-pointer2019102320191017
4377239296 0 062077 856 864reficc_-march=core-avx-i_-mtune=core-avx-i_-O3_-fomit-frame-pointer2019102320191017
4379238944 0 061693 856 864reficc_-march=core-avx-i_-mtune=core-avx-i_-O2_-fomit-frame-pointer2019102320191017
4379838944 0 061693 856 864reficc_-march=sandybridge_-mtune=sandybridge_-O2_-fomit-frame-pointer2019102320191017
4381639296 0 062077 856 864reficc_-march=sandybridge_-mtune=sandybridge_-O3_-fomit-frame-pointer2019102320191017
445925128 8 021819 832 896refgc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102320191017
4476640912 0 064181 856 928reficc_-march=skylake-avx512_-mtune=skylake-avx512_-O3_-fomit-frame-pointer2019102320191017
447866856 8 026263 840 896refgc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102320191017
4480236656 0 058093 856 864reficc_-march=corei7_-mtune=corei7_-O2_-fomit-frame-pointer2019102320191017
4482637024 0 058517 856 864reficc_-march=corei7_-mtune=corei7_-O3_-fomit-frame-pointer2019102320191017
4496040448 0 064357 856 928reficc_-march=icelake-client_-mtune=icelake-client_-O2_-fomit-frame-pointer2019102320191017
4516440576 0 063957 856 928reficc_-march=skylake-avx512_-mtune=skylake-avx512_-O2_-fomit-frame-pointer2019102320191017
4529440928 0 063629 856 864reficc_-march=haswell_-mtune=haswell_-O3_-fomit-frame-pointer2019102320191017
4530440576 0 063677 856 864reficc_-march=broadwell_-mtune=broadwell_-O2_-fomit-frame-pointer2019102320191017
4530440912 0 063613 856 864reficc_-march=broadwell_-mtune=broadwell_-O3_-fomit-frame-pointer2019102320191017
4531640576 0 063677 856 864reficc_-march=core-avx2_-mtune=core-avx2_-O2_-fomit-frame-pointer2019102320191017
4531840576 0 063677 856 864reficc_-march=skylake_-mtune=skylake_-O2_-fomit-frame-pointer2019102320191017
4532640928 0 063629 856 864reficc_-march=core-avx2_-mtune=core-avx2_-O3_-fomit-frame-pointer2019102320191017
4535440736 0 064293 856 928reficc_-march=icelake-client_-mtune=icelake-client_-O3_-fomit-frame-pointer2019102320191017
4538640576 0 063677 856 864reficc_-march=haswell_-mtune=haswell_-O2_-fomit-frame-pointer2019102320191017
4539440912 0 063613 856 864reficc_-march=skylake_-mtune=skylake_-O3_-fomit-frame-pointer2019102320191017
467903938 8 020355 832 896refgc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2019102320191017

Test failure

Implementation: crypto_aead/norx6461v1/ref
Compiler: icc -march=cannonlake -mtune=cannonlake -O2 -fomit-frame-pointer
error 111

Number of similar (compiler,implementation) pairs: 6, namely:
CompilerImplementations
icc -march=cannonlake -mtune=cannonlake -O2 -fomit-frame-pointer ref xmm ymm
icc -march=cannonlake -mtune=cannonlake -O3 -fomit-frame-pointer ref xmm ymm